==History==
Akira was one of the children who grew up in the [[Shelter]] as a stock body for Kamui. His history after this is largely a mystery, and there are signs of his government registration having been deleted. Eventually, he was recruited into Republic by [[Daigo Natsume]], where he was trained in firing bullets for the first time. He stayed on with Republic until Operation Secure Kamui in 1999, a mission of which he was the sole survivor. He was soon after discovered at [[IMM Hospital]] by Kusabi and [[Sumio Kodai]], who decided to take him with them due to him being the only witness. He ended up assisting in the Kamui Case despite not being an actual member of the HC Unit; he was later officially hired during {{CL|2}}, as a member of Unit 2 along with Kusabi and Sumio.

After the execution of Kamui in {{CL|5}}, Akira found his way to the Shelter while investigating the [[TRUMP]]. As he discovered his past, various characters began referring to him as Kamui, suggesting that he is the next body that [[Kamui Uehara]] was going to transfer into. Akira ascended the [[TV Tower]] with Kusabi, who changed his mind, telling him that's it up to him whether he becomes Kamui or not. At the top, they confronted [[Nezu]], and Akira shot him, symbolically releasing Akira from his past. After this, Akira met with Tetsu at the [[Tamura]] cafe in {{CL|!}}, where they talked about the events of the game. Curiously, despite presumably staying on with the HC Unit, Akira is not mentioned to have been involved with any of the cases on the [[History of 24th Ward|history timeline]] on the official website.

In 2003, as shown in [[06 white out|#06 white out]], [[Sakura Natsume]] was his new commanding officer. While underground looking for the [[Joker]], Mokutaro Shiroyabu mistakenly believed Akira to be the Joker instead. He shouted at Akira to answer him, but being mute, Akira could not; before Shiro could fire, though, Kusabi interrupted the altercation. Kusabi cleared up the misunderstanding, and Akira and Shiroyabu worked together to go after the Joker. They cornered him at the [[Hachisuka Dome]]; however, following the conclusion of the case, nothing is known of what happened to Akira.
